Boosting Academic Research Skills for Postgraduate and Doctoral Students
Academic research is a crucial aspect of postgraduate and doctoral studies. It's a process involving data collection and analysis to generate new knowledge. However, many students find it challenging, particularly at these advanced levels. Fortunately, several steps can improve academic research abilities.
Firstly, investing in research skills is essential. This means taking courses in research methodology, statistics, and data analysis. These skills are critical for conducting high-quality research studies.
Secondly, seeking mentorship from experienced researchers is highly beneficial. A mentor can provide guidance on research design, data collection, and analysis. They can also help identify research gaps and develop relevant research questions.
Thirdly, familiarizing oneself with different research tools and resources is vital. This may include online databases, academic journals, and research libraries. These resources offer a wealth of information for comprehensive research.
Fourthly, collaboration with other researchers is advantageous. It allows students to share ideas, knowledge, and resources. Collaboration fosters the development of new research skills and professional networks.
Lastly, students should continuously seek feedback on their research work. Feedback from peers, mentors, and professors helps identify areas for improvement and enhances research skills.
In conclusion, improving academic research abilities is crucial for postgraduate and doctoral students. By investing in research skills, seeking mentorship, becoming familiar with research tools and resources, collaborating with other researchers, and seeking feedback, students can enhance their research abilities and conduct high-quality research studies.
